Project Manager for Defence Infrastructure Projects
Our organization is seeking an experienced Project Manager to lead the delivery of infrastructure projects in the Defence sector. The successful candidate will have a proven track record in managing construction projects, ideally within the Defence or Government sector.
Key Responsibilities
- Manage infrastructure projects from initiation to closure, ensuring timely completion and within budget.
- Build and maintain strong relationships with stakeholders through proactive engagement.
- Ensure procurement activities comply with Commonwealth Procurement Rules.
- Manage project documentation and reporting in line with Defence and organization standards.
- Capture and share lessons learned to improve future project delivery.
Requirements
The ideal candidate will possess:
- A Bachelor's degree in a relevant field (e.g. Business, Engineering, Construction Management).
- A current Baseline Security Clearance (or ability to maintain one).
- Proven experience managing construction projects, ideally within the Defence or Government sector.
- Familiarity with project management methodologies such as PMBOK, PRINCE2, or Agile.
- Strong understanding of government procurement practices and compliance standards.
- Excellent stakeholder engagement and communication skills.
